JohnDow Adds Oil Container Drainer to Product Line

The new product is geared toward the company's focus on environmental responsibility when it comes to draining and disposing of oil.

JohnDow Industries (JDI), a shop and equipment, vehicle exhaust removal, and back-shop supplies provider, recently introduced its newest oil-handling product, the Oil Container Drainer, to its service equipment division.

With an increased environmental focus on the proper disposal of oil, JohnDow developed the Oil Container Drainer so repairers can safely and easily drain oil bottles before recycling. With its simple yet effective design, the Oil Container Drainer features a cabinet-like structure where technicians can place bottles upside down on pegs and excess oil drains from the container into a connected drum.

Ad Loading...

Features include:

  • Easy open, hinged, and lockable lid doors.

  • Easily secures on drums. (Drum not included.)

  • Hooks to stabilize larger bottles for easy drainage.

  • Adjustable feet to secure container on drum.

  • Two side supports to keep lid open at 45 degrees.

  • Holds up to 18 bottles.

  • Heavy-duty steel construction.

“Increased state and local environmental regulations around the proper disposal of oil has made repairers identify an effective excess oil draining process,” said Brian Morgan, national sales manager for JohnDow Industries Service Equipment. “One of our core principles focuses on helping solve these types of technician issues, and this Oil Container Drainer provides an easy, yet effective solution."
